Does Remote Play use Wi-Fi?

Yes, Remote Play heavily relies on Wi-Fi (or mobile data) for a stable connection, acting as the bridge between your device and your PlayStation console, requiring a strong internet connection (at least 5Mbps, 15Mbps recommended) for streaming games, though it can sometimes work locally on the same network without the internet once connected. For the best experience, Sony recommends connecting your PS5 console via Ethernet and your device via a fast 5GHz Wi-Fi network, or using a wired connection for both, to avoid lag and ensure smooth gameplay.

Do you need to be on the same Wi-Fi to use Remote Play?

No, Remote Play does not have to be on the same network; you can play from anywhere with a strong internet connection, but the initial setup requires you to be on the same network to link the devices, and your console needs to be in Rest Mode and connected to the internet to be accessible remotely. A high-speed broadband connection (at least 5Mbps, 15Mbps recommended) is crucial for a good experience, as mobile data can be inconsistent, though some users report success with it.

Why doesn't PS Remote Play work on mobile data?

PS Remote Play often fails on mobile data due to carrier restrictions, network congestion, or port blocking (UDP 8572), requiring a strong, stable 5+ Mbps connection. To fix it, restart devices, check carrier settings (like APN), disable VPNs/data savers, use airplane mode to reset connection, ensure your PS console is ready, and verify your home network's port forwarding if needed; if issues persist, contact your mobile carrier, as some restrict the traffic.

How far away can you PS5 Remote Play?

PS5 Remote Play works anywhere in the world as long as you have a fast, stable internet connection at both your location and your home console, though performance drastically drops with distance and poor internet, introducing significant lag, making competitive games unplayable but casual gaming possible. It's about internet quality, not physical proximity, with strong home Wi-Fi crucial for success.

How to improve Wi-Fi for Remote Play?

Experiencing Poor Streaming Quality?
  1. Choose the 5 GHz WiFi band over the highly congested 2.4 GHz band. ...
  2. Choose a WiFi channel on the Access Point (AP) that isn't congested. ...
  3. Set the AP to use a 5GHz channel near the top of the band; the top end starts at channel 149.

What is needed for PS Remote Play?

To use PlayStation Remote Play, you need a PS4/PS5 console, the PS Remote Play app on a compatible device (PC, Mac, mobile, Portal), a fast internet connection (5-15Mbps+ recommended), and a DualSense/DualShock controller (or touch controls) for a smooth experience. Ensure your console's software is updated and your console is on or in Rest Mode, connected to broadband.

What are the limitations of PlayStation Remote Play?

PS Remote Play on a PS4 Pro console

You can't remotely play games in 4K from your PS4™Pro console, but up to 1080p may be available depending on hardware and bandwidth limitations. This is limited to 720p on standard PS4 consoles.

Why is PS5 Remote Play so slow?

PS5 Remote Play lag is usually caused by poor network connection, but can also stem from TV settings or console configurations; fix it by using a wired Ethernet connection, reducing streaming quality (540p/standard frame rate), lowering bit rate, using 5GHz Wi-Fi, checking your NAT Type (Type 1/Open is best), disabling HDR, and ensuring your TV's Auto Low Latency Mode (ALLM) or "Game Mode" is active. A stable, fast local network (LAN) between your console and device is key for the best experience, even if playing from afar.

How long does 5GB of hotspot last for gaming?

5GB of hotspot data for gaming can last anywhere from a few hours to over 20 hours, depending heavily on the game's data usage (e.g., <100MB/hr for Minecraft vs. >200MB/hr for Call of Duty), with lighter games stretching it longer and demanding games burning through it quickly, especially if you're also updating or streaming. For most players, 5GB is enough for casual, short sessions but not for heavy, daily gaming or large game downloads.
